# Who to Contact: Inventory Reconciliation Job (StockMender)

The nightly StockMender reconciliation job compares warehouse counts against the Ledgerline catalog and files discrepancy reports before 06:00. Ownership rotates quarterly; the current steward is the Fulfillment Platform team in the Harrowick office. For schedule changes, raise them at the weekly eng sync. For urgent mismatches or failed runs, contact the team directly at the address below.

escalation mailbox, bafog-fafog: ulador@paliqlabs.internal

Q3 Planning — FX Hedging

Decision: Vantrell Systems will hedge 70% of projected Norlandic krona exposure through Q4, up from 50%. Rationale: the Meridia expansion doubles our krona receivables and treasury flagged volatility post-election. Forward contracts preferred over options; cost ceiling 0.8% of notional. Deltaro desk executes by month-end. Unhedged remainder reviewed monthly. Finance team: update the cash-flow model accordingly and flag any counterparty limits. Context for the decision follows below.

board note of fahif-yahog: Gross margin on Wenath came in at 10 percent against a plan of 5 percent. Only 3 of the 100 pilot accounts renewed Wenath, so a churn review is set for July 15.

## Ownership

Heads up, release managers: the `stringsift` script is what pulls all translatable strings out of the Quillbird codebase and bundles them for the localization vendors. It runs as part of the release pipeline, so if it chokes, your release chokes. Don't patch it ad hoc — there are subtle escaping rules for pluralized strings that will absolutely bite you. File an issue instead, and for anything urgent or pipeline-blocking, go straight to the maintainer named below.

account owner for fajep-yagef: Kasix Eliiel